计算机操作系统主要包括Windows、macOS、Linux、Android、iOS等。Windows和macOS是常见的桌面操作系统,Linux则是一种开源的操作系统,广泛应用于服务器和各种设备中。Android和iOS则是移动设备上广泛使用的操作系统。

本文目录导读:

  1. 计算机操作系统的定义
  2. 计算机操作系统的主要功能
  3. 计算机操作系统的发展历程
  4. 计算机操作系统在当今社会的重要性

计算机操作系统:核心与灵魂

在数字化时代,计算机操作系统作为计算机硬件与软件之间的桥梁,扮演着至关重要的角色,本文将深入探讨计算机操作系统的定义、功能、发展历程以及在当今社会的重要性,旨在为读者全面解析这一核心与灵魂般的存在。

计算机操作系统的定义

计算机操作系统是管理计算机硬件与软件资源的程序,是计算机系统的核心组成部分,它负责协调计算机的各项活动,包括任务调度、内存管理、设备驱动、文件系统等,为应用程序提供一个稳定、高效的运行环境。

计算机操作系统的主要功能

1、任务调度:操作系统负责管理计算机的任务调度,确保各个任务能够按照优先级和顺序得到执行。

2、内存管理:操作系统负责管理计算机的内存资源,包括内存的分配、回收和保护,以提高内存的使用效率。

计算机操作系统有哪些  第1张

图片来自网络

3、设备驱动:操作系统提供设备驱动程序,使得计算机能够与各种硬件设备进行通信和交互。

4、文件系统:操作系统提供文件系统,用于组织和管理计算机中的文件和目录,方便用户进行数据的存储和访问。

计算机操作系统的发展历程

自20世纪50年代以来,计算机操作系统经历了从简单到复杂、从集中到分散的发展历程,以下是几个重要的里程碑:

1、批处理操作系统:最早出现的操作系统是批处理操作系统,它通过将多个作业组合在一起,一次性输入到计算机中进行处理,提高了计算机的利用率。

2、分时操作系统:随着计算机技术的发展,分时操作系统应运而生,它允许多个用户同时使用计算机,提高了计算机的共享性和交互性。

3、实时操作系统:实时操作系统主要用于需要快速响应的场合,如工业控制、航空航天等领域,它能够实时调度任务,确保关键任务的及时执行。

4、现代操作系统:现代操作系统具有更加丰富的功能和更加复杂的结构,包括网络支持、图形界面、多任务处理等特性,它们为应用程序提供了一个稳定、高效的运行环境,使得计算机能够更好地满足用户的需求。

计算机操作系统在当今社会的重要性

计算机操作系统作为计算机系统的核心与灵魂,在当今社会扮演着至关重要的角色,它不仅管理着计算机的硬件和软件资源,还为应用程序提供了一个稳定、高效的运行环境,以下是计算机操作系统在当今社会的重要性:

1、提高工作效率:计算机操作系统通过任务调度和内存管理等功能,使得多个任务能够同时进行,提高了工作效率,它还提供了丰富的应用程序接口,方便用户进行数据的存储和访问。

2、保障数据安全:计算机操作系统通过提供加密、备份和恢复等功能,保障了数据的安全性,它还对恶意软件和病毒进行防范和查杀,保护了计算机系统的安全。

3、促进科技进步:计算机操作系统的发展推动了科技的进步,它为各种应用提供了强大的支持,如人工智能、大数据、云计算等,这些应用的发展又进一步推动了社会的进步和发展。

4、改变生活方式:计算机操作系统已经深入到人们生活的方方面面,它不仅改变了人们的工作方式,还改变了人们的娱乐、学习和交流方式,人们可以通过计算机操作系统使用各种应用程序,如社交媒体、在线购物、在线教育等,使生活更加便捷和丰富。

计算机操作系统作为计算机系统的核心与灵魂,具有至关重要的作用,它不仅管理着计算机的硬件和软件资源,还为应用程序提供了一个稳定、高效的运行环境,在数字化时代,计算机操作系统的发展将继续推动科技的进步和社会的发展,我们应该重视计算机操作系统的发展和应用,为人类创造更加美好的未来。